The Blessed Life

Hymnal: The Psalter #305 (1912) Meter: 8.8.8.8 Topics: Godly Fear Blessedness of First Line: How blest the man who fears the Lord Lyrics: 1 How blest the man who fears the Lord And greatly loves God's holy will; His children share his great reward, And blessings all their days shall fill. 2 Abounding wealth shall bless his home, His righteousness shall still endure; To him shall light arise in gloom, For he is merciful and pure. 3 The man whose hand the weak befriends In judgment shall his cause maintain; A peace unmoved his life attends, And long his mem'ry shall remain. 4 Of evil tidings not afraid, His trust is in the Lord alone; His heart is steadfast, undismayed, For he shall see his foes o'erthrown. 5 With kind remembrance of the poor, For their distress his gifts provide; His righteousness shall thus endure, His name in honor shall abide. 6 To shame the wicked shall be brought, While righteous men shall favor gain; Unrighteous hopes shall come to naught, Its due reward shall sin obtain. Scripture: Psalm 112 Languages: English Tune Title: WELTON

Worship the Lord in the beauty of holiness

Author: John Samuel Bewley Monsell, 1811-75 Hymnal: Together in Song #454 (1999) Topics: Comfort; Confidence; Epiphany; Fear; Glory of God; Hope; Humility; Obedience; Our Gifts to God; Our Love to God; People of God; Purity; Sincerity; Worship Gathering; Worship The Offering Lyrics: 1 Worship the Lord in the beauty of holiness, bow down before him, his glory proclaim; gold of obedience and incense of lowliness bring, and adore him: the Lord is his name. 2 Low at his feet lay your burden of carefulness, high on his heart he will bear it for you, comfort your sorrows, and answer your prayerfulness, guiding your steps in the way best for you. 3 Fear not to enter his courts in the slenderness of the poor wealth you would reckon to own: truth in its beauty and love in its tenderness, these are the offerings to bring to his throne. 4 These, though we bring them in trembling and fearfulness, he will accept for the name that is dear, mornings of joy give for evenings of tearfulness, trust for our trembling and hope for our fear. 5 Worship the Lord in the beauty of holiness, bow down before him, his glory proclaim; gold of obedience and incense of lowliness, bring, and adore him: the Lord is his name. Scripture: 1 Chronicles 16:29-33 Languages: English Tune Title: WAS LEBET

Gently, Lord, O gently lead us

Author: Dr. Thomas Hastings, 1784-1872 Hymnal: Methodist Hymn and Tune Book #456 (1917) Topics: God Gentleness; God Guidance of; God Gentleness; God Guidance of; Afflictions Christ with us in; The Christian Life Aspiration and Prayer; Death Fear of removed; Guidance Implored; Purity Of Heart; Suffering Human; Temptation Lyrics: 1 Gently, Lord, O gently lead us Through this gloomy vale of tears; And, O Lord, in mercy give us Thy rich grace in all our fears. 2 When temptation's darts assail us, When in devious paths we stray, Let Thy goodness never fail us, Lead us in Thy perfect way. 3 In the hour of pain and anguish, In the hour when death draws near, Suffer not our hearts to languish, Suffer not our souls to fear. 4 When this mortal life is ended, Bid us in Thine arms to rest, Till, by angel-brands attended, We awake among the blest. Languages: English Tune Title: HAWLEY
